Hatzolah
EMS is a volunteer Jewish
EMS response organization. They are most prevelant in the NYC, northern New Jersey area. The medics tend to be pretty decent, many EMTs not so much. Between the NYC culture, and the Orthodox Jewish culture, things get interesting.
New York
law provides for volunteer
EMS members to be equipped with green lights only with no right of way rights. New York
law also allows for red lights/sirens to EMT-B, EMT-I and EMT-P's PROVIDED that their vehicle is inspected by the department of health and allowed by the
EMS agency policy. Its NOT a given right.
By
law (last time I checked) they are required to display the NYS Inspection sticker on their vehicle, but you never seen one (in violation of the code).
(NJ and most other states are simialar but NJ runs blue instead of green just like the fighterfighters with no ROW rights).
Now, in 99% of New York State, just about everyone is allowed the green lights and not so much red lights are used by "rank and file".
